What You Will Be Doing Our professionals are the most important resource in our service commitment to our customers. We nurture a progressive environment where challenging, empowered, and purposeful work is celebrated.
Our world-class
Firefighters provide fire protection and emergency medical services for the preservation of life and property. This is accomplished by responding to emergency calls, providing emergency medical services, hazardous materials responses, completing firefighting and rescue activities, providing public education, and inspecting and testing plans and equipment. Other duties include maintaining the fire station and hazmat operations, performing inspections of commercial properties, conducting tours, inspecting equipment, and performing related duties as assigned.

What You Bring To Us - A High School Diploma or equivalent.
- Minimum age is 19.
- Minimum qualifications vary depending on position.
- Possession of Paramedic certification from the Texas Department of State Health Services National Registry Paramedic certification (unless otherwise posted).
- Possession of Texas Commission Basic Fire Protection certification (unless otherwise posted).
- Possession of Emergency Medical Technician certification is required (unless candidate possesses a Paramedic license).
